No Heat or Blowing Cold Air

No heat or blowing cold air often frustrates residents first. This problem most frequently results from control unit problems, ignition component failure, obstructed air filters, or tripped safety switches. Across areas with high particulate levels like Glendale and Burbank, air filters clog quickly, significantly restricting circulation and triggering protective shutdowns as a safeguard. Control issues can consist of exhausted batteries, wrong configurations, or damaged connections.

If the fan continues working yet delivers unheated air, the cause commonly relates to the heat exchanger or fuel delivery. Furnace Short Cycling Explained

Furnace short cycling disrupts heating cycles and prompts questions regarding performance. The system starts providing short bursts of heat, before shutting down too soon, continuing this incomplete pattern. This behavior usually stems from safety overheating controls activating due to restricted airflow, dirty flame sensors, or incorrectly sized systems.

Across areas such as San Fernando Valley and Pasadena, dust buildup makes this issue particularly common during the first cold snaps each winter. Residents notice increased utility usage and uneven heating throughout the home.

Common Triggers

Blocked air filters, restricted ventilation, malfunctioning safety switches, and oversized units commonly cause short cycling. All these elements restricts airflow or causes premature shutdowns.

Unusual Noises from Your Furnace

Unusual noises including rattling, banging, or squealing indicate mechanical problems demanding immediate evaluation. Loose panels commonly produce loose panels or debris in the system, whereas banging typically results from ductwork expanding and contracting. Squealing typically points to deteriorated blower bearings or drive belts.

How Much Does Furnace Repair Near Me Typically Cost in Southern California?

Furnace repair near me expenses reflect exact nature of the repair, necessary components, plus labor requirements. In Southern California, common standard services fall between $130 to $600, thereby making early detection financially advantageous versus full replacement.

Breakdown of Common Repair Costs

Ignition or flame sensor service and part replacement usually falls between $150 up to $350, representing one of the most frequent repairs. Blower motor or capacitor replacement normally costs between $300–$600 owing to installation complexity. Short cycling troubleshooting and repair usually ranges $200 and $500 based on needed corrections.

Frequently Asked Questions About Furnace Repair Near Me

Why is my furnace blowing cold air?
Blowing cold air frequently arises due to a clogged air filter, thermostat issues, or failed ignition. Start by replacing the filter to restore airflow. What causes furnace short cycling?
Short cycling results from overheating from dirty filters, restricted air pathways, malfunctioning sensors, or mismatched system capacity. It results in reduced performance plus equipment stress. How often should I change my furnace filter?
Change filters 1 to 3 months, with greater frequency where dust accumulates quickly. Clean filters keep air movement optimal, efficiency, while preventing numerous common issues. Explore best practices on our maintenance services page.
